Output 31d824891a1a777a6deddc1eb35bcc18f5758447034774902a46ba4bce574c94:2

value
200000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c3441295bfc883d039cfbe7042e7386209398323 OP_EQUALVERIFY OP_CHECKSIG
address
1JoUKB65dnwUTPVPTeRPNQKySod8C6ZXmb
transaction
31d824891a1a777a6deddc1eb35bcc18f5758447034774902a46ba4bce574c94
confirmations
424025
spent
true